international conference on electrical machines and systems | 2009

Research on characteristics of single-sided linear induction motors for urban transit

Yumei Du; Nengqiang Jin

As a direct electromagnetic driving device without adhesion, the urban transit with single-sided linear induction motor (SLIM) propulsion and wheel on rail support and guidance has many advantages, and has been a part of new type transit. In this paper, a SLIM for urban transit was designed and its characteristics were calculated with improving T-type equivalent circuit model. The specific structure problems of a SLIM such as end effects, half-filled slots for the end windings, skin effect have been taken into account in the design. The prototype has been tested, and the accuracy of the calculation is verified by experimental results.


international conference on electrical machines and systems | 2011

Study and optimized design of contactless power transformer for high speed maglev train

Ying Zhang; Ruihua Zhang; Yumei Du

This paper investigates factors influencing coupling ability of ironless flat winding separable transformer which could work for the contactless power supply system of the high speed maglev train. Basing on 3D finite element method (FEM), the coupling ability to geometrical sizes such as coil length and width, height of air gap and the horizontal displacement of the secondary coils is given. Effect of high frequency on the contactless power supply system is also taken into consideration. The work of this paper provides foundation for the optimized design of high coupling ability ironless flat winding separable transformer.


ieee transportation electrification conference and expo asia pacific | 2014

Design of a medium frequency, high voltage transformer for power electronic transformer

Juanjuan Zhang; Yumei Du; Zixin Li; Ping Wang

Power electronics transformers (PETs) have better application in smart grid because they have more advantages than conventional transformers with a structure integrating the power electronic equipment and medium frequency transformers (MF transformers). As an important part of PET, the MF transformer undertakes significant functions of voltage conversion, energy transfer and electrical isolation. Its performance determines the efficiency and reliability of the overall system. This paper mainly discusses design procedure and efficiency optimization of MF transformers. The method of computing leakage inductance is also presented to achieve the series resonance. Finally the optimal MF transformer prototype is validated with finite element simulation.


international conference on applied superconductivity and electromagnetic devices | 2009

Performance analysis of a linear induction motor based on the finite element method

Tiejun Zhou; Yumei Du; Junfei Han; Wei Xu

Single-sided Linear Induction Motors (SLIMs) have been widely applied in transportation recently. For its cut-open magnet circuit along moving direction and different width between primary and secondary, it has longitudinal end effect and transversal edge effect, which bring some effluence to its mutual inductance and secondary resistance. Furthermore, SLIM has normal force for its unsymmetrical structure in vertical direction, which is evident in large slip and current region so as to interfere the propulsion control schemes. According to these SLIM traits, this paper based on the finite element method employed by the commercial software ANSOFT has investigated SLIM transient thrust, normal force, air gap flux density distribution, where the thrust is verified by the measurement. The results indicate that the 2D model can provide comparatively reasonable prediction to the SLIM electromagnetic design and control schemes implementation.


international conference on advanced intelligent mechatronics | 2008

Dynamic characteristics study of single-sided linear induction motor with finite element method

Junfei Han; Yaohua Li; Yumei Du; Wei Xu; Nengqiang Jin

Single-sided linear induction motor (SLIM) is widely used in transportation and other field in need of linear drive for their simple, firm structure and linear motion feature without the translation mechanism. But end effect in SLIM deteriorate the performance for the discontinuous magnetic circuit. This paper analyzes 2-D transient electromagnetic field of SLIM by finite element method (FEM). The electromagnetic field-motion coupling problem was handled by the interpolation linear movement interface method. The torque was calculated by nodal force method. The variation and correlation of eddy current and electromagnetic force with respective frequency is studied in detail as well as flux density. The changing trend of longitudinal end effect in SLIM whole operation process and the influence to dynamic characteristics of SLIM is presented. The conclusions presented in this paper can give good theoretical guidance to the control and design of linear induction motor.


international conference on electrical machines and systems | 2015

Analysis of contactless power transfer system characteristics influenced by multi-primary multi-secondary contactless transformer

Yajie Zhao; Yumei Du; Hua Cai; Ruihua Zhang; Liming Shi

Contactless power transfer (CPT) system is widely used in high power occasion recently. The characteristics of movable loosely coupled transformer (MLCT) in CPT system have powerful influences to the performance of whole system. This paper studies a kind of CPT system with multi-primary multi-secondary contactless transformer. By establishing the equivalent circuit of CPT system, this paper analysis the characteristics of system such as output current, output voltage, output power and efficiency, influenced by the internal resistance, mutual inductance and frequency of multi-primary multi-secondary contactless transformer. Moreover, a further simulation has done to prove the theoretical analysis.


international conference on electrical machines and systems | 2014

The influence on characteristics of movable loosely coupled transformer from metal units in urban railway system

Yajie Zhao; Yumei Du; Hua Cail; Ruihua Zhang; Liming Shi

Contactless power transfer (CPT) system is widely used in high power recently. The characteristics of contactless transformer in CPT system have powerful influences on the performance of whole system. This paper studies the performance on movable loosely coupled transformer (MLCT) for CPT system, which can be used in rail transit system. Making use of 3D finite element methods, this paper investigates how much influence on MLCT produced by metal units in urban railway system, including the fixing units on the vehicle and the metal units on the ground. The results of such studies have great practical significance when the CPT system applied to urban railway system.


ieee transportation electrification conference and expo asia pacific | 2014

Torque ripple reduction in brushless DC motor drives

Ziyu Wu; Haifeng Wang; Guobiao Gu; Yumei Du

This paper proposed a novel dual closed loop control of speed and torque method in brushless DC motor (BLDCM) drivers based on genetic algorithm. By defining speed error and torque error as optimum objective functions, using genetic algorithm, the PID parameters can be optimized. In addition, the torque ripple during commutation has been analyzed, and a variable switch conduction mode has been introduced to reduce torque ripple during commutation. The simulation results show that the torque ripple of BLDCM can be eliminated effectively during the commutation period and non-commutation period.


international conference on electrical machines and systems | 2017

Research on speed sensorless method for permanent magnet linear synchronous motor based on high frequency pulsating voltage signal injection

Meng Zhou; Ruihua Zhang; Yumei Du; Qiongxuan Ge

The position and speed detection of maglev train is critical to train control system. The common methods of speed measurement include speed sensor measurement and speed sensorless measurement. The use of sensorless method can significantly reduce costs and its not influenced by various environmental factors. In this paper, a high frequency pulsating voltage injection method is proposed for the PMLSM, which is used to calculate the speed and position information of the motor. This method is suitable for low speed measurement and it can be used for the permanent magnet linear synchronous motor (PMLSM) with non-salient pole machine. The effectiveness of the method is verified by experiment results.


international conference on electrical machines and systems | 2017

Speed sensorless control of maglev permanent magnet linear synchronous motor based on sliding mode observer

Chaochao You; Ruihua Zhang; Yumei Du; Qiongxuan Ge

In order to solve the difficulty of measuring the speed and the position of maglev permanent magnet linear synchronous motor (PMLSM), a speed sensorless back electromotive force (EMF)-based sliding mode is proposed. And to overcome the drawback of the sliding mode technique called chattering phenomenon, a series of improvements are provided.
